Also if a supplier asks ahead of time, do not mention your trade-in or your desire to get an auto loan




If you discuss the cost down to $22,000 first, and then state your trade-in, you might end up getting a rate under the dealership's low end of $20,000. Many automobile salespeople have established sales objectives for the end of each month and quarter. Strategy your browse through to the supplier near to these calendar times, and you might obtain a much better offer or additional savings if they still require to reach their allocation.

After you've discussed the final auto rate, ask the supplier regarding any kind of deals or programs you get approved for or state any you located online to bring the price down much more. Speaking of claiming the best points, do not tell the dealer what month-to-month payment you're seeking. If you want the very best bargain, start settlements by asking the supplier what the out-the-door price is.

Remember those taxes and fees we claimed you'll have to pay when acquiring a car? Suppliers can expand loan settlement terms to strike your target month-to-month settlement while not reducing the out-the-door cost, and you'll end up paying more interest in the long run.


Both you and the dealership are qualified to a reasonable deal however you'll likely end up paying a little even more than you desire and the dealership will likely get a little much less than they want. Always begin arrangements by asking what the out-the-door cost is and go from there. If the dealership isn't going reduced enough, you may have the ability to bargain some certain products to get closer to your wanted cost.

The wholesale price is what suppliers pay for used vehicles at public auction. Wholesale cost drops generally come before list price stop by 6 to eight weeks. A rate decrease is always an excellent sign for used auto buyers. However prior to you begin doing the happy-car-shopper dancing, remember the market is still challenging.


Passion rates, traditionally greater for made use of vehicle finances than brand-new car lendings, are progressively intensifying. In various other words, if you fund a secondhand auto, the month-to-month payments will be greater currently than a year earlier.

There are more unknowns in a peer-to-peer (P2P) transaction. A solid reason for purchasing peer-to-peer is since the vendor has the auto you desire at a reasonable rate.


Furthermore, a private seller does not need to cover the overhead expenditures a dealership creates. A dealership is truly a middleman in the transaction, creating the required earnings by blowing up the acquisition cost when offering the automobile. Nevertheless, at the end of the day, the peer-to-peer offer will only be just as good as the buyer's negotiating abilities.


In theory, a personal vendor's initial asking rate will certainly be less than a dealership's rate for the factors made a list of above. Negotiating a purchase cost with a private vendor must begin at a reduced threshold than when negotiating with a dealership. This, however, isn't a customer's only advantage. By the time the buyer and vendor reach the bargaining stage, the private vendor has invested a great deal of time in marketing you a car.
